Marakesh is my girlfriend and i favorite restaurant! :) we go there on almost every trip! A plate is around 10-$12. I always get the lemon chicken. And if you go for dinner you can watch a belly dancing show.
 
Located in Epcot in the World Showcase. It is part of the Moroccan pavilion. food is very good.

I have always been a fan of Marrakesh and I have never had a bad experience there. If you are concerned about the food, consider trying it at lunch when the prices are cheaper. At leas that way, you won't be out much if you don't like it.
 
This is our "Must Do" resturant every time we're there, love the food. My wife is usually a picky eater, but she enjoys the food there a lot. Plus, the Moroccan wine is very good, too.

Price wise, I'd put it as fairly expensive as WDW resturants go, but not the priciest you'll pay at Epcot. (Le Cellier and Coral Reef are probably more expensive.)
